#91127f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#91127f is composed of 56.9% red, 7.1% green and 49.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.6% magenta, 12.4%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 308.5 degrees, a saturation of 77.9% and a lightness of 32%. #91127f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ff24fe with #230000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#91127f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#91127f has RGB values of R:145, G:18, B:127 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.12,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 9507455.
